About the role

Job Description: Junior I&E Designer
Location: Deer Park, Texas
Company: Burrow Global, LLC

Overview:
Burrow Global is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Junior I&E Designer to join our team in Deer Park, Texas. As a Junior I&E Designer, you will operate under detailed instructions and review, providing essential technical knowledge and performing tasks to support our services. This entry-level role offers an exciting opportunity to gain hands-on experience in the development and execution of I&E (Instrument and Electrical) designs, contributing to the competitiveness of Burrow Global within the global marketplace.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the preparation of 2D Computer-Aided Design (CAD) drawings, including instrument location plans, isometrics, and sketches.
  • Learn to analyze and make recommendations regarding solutions to complex problems based on project objectives and guidelines.
  • Develop and review design specifications, including design criteria, under supervision.
  • Review drawings and vendor equipment documentation for compliance with project requirements and assist in resolving discrepancies.
  • Assist with the development and checking of drawings, including instrument index and location plans.
  • Adhere to industry codes and standards as well as department practices and procedures.
  • Gain exposure to different areas of the I&E design process and develop a strong understanding of technical design principles.

Basic Job Requirements:

  • A combination of education and directly related experience equivalent to 1-2 years.
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to effectively interact with team members, supervisors, and clients.
  • Ability to learn and apply knowledge of applicable local, state/province, and federal/national statutes and guidelines.
  • Attention to detail and the ability to work in a time-conscious and efficient manner.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Accredited two (2) year degree or global equivalent in a technical field of study.
  • Basic knowledge of design software (AutoCAD, MicroStation).
  • Familiarity with fieldwork and practical design experience.
  • Proficiency in computer software, including word processing, e-mail, spreadsheets, and presentation programs.
